Reading RTP and Volatility Like a Pro
Return-to-player percentage, or RTP, tells you the theoretical share of every pound wagered that a slot pays back over an endless sequence of spins. A game with a 96% RTP will, in theory, return £96 for every £100 staked. This is a mathematical average, not a guarantee for any individual session. The practical takeaway is simple: choose games with RTPs at or above 96%, as the house edge narrows with every percentage point.
All UK-licensed online slots use certified random number generators, which are independently tested by accredited laboratories to ensure outcomes cannot be predicted or manipulated. The UK Gambling Commission requires licensed operators to display their licence number, and this certification extends to the fairness of every game in their lobby. When you play at a site carrying a valid UKGC licence, you have a regulatory guarantee that the RNG is functioning as intended. The Feature Mechanics That Define Modern Slots
Megaways mechanics, pioneered by Big Time Gaming, replace fixed paylines with a variable number of ways to win on each spin, often reaching 117,649 possibilities. This unpredictability is the core appeal: the reel configuration changes constantly, and a single spin can trigger an avalanche of cascading wins. Jackpot slots, meanwhile, set aside a fraction of every stake to build a prize that swells until a lucky player lands it. These progressive jackpots can climb into seven figures, but they typically carry lower base-game RTP to fund the prize pool.
Hold and nudge mechanics, once the preserve of classic fruit machines, have been reimagined for the digital era. Games like the hold-and-win genre present a grid of coins, and you collect symbols to fill the board and trigger a respin sequence. These features add a layer of skill perception, though the outcome remains purely random. The best slots integrate these mechanics seamlessly, so the features feel like a natural extension of the theme rather than a gimmick bolted on to justify a higher stake.
Stake Limits and Structuring Your Session
British players operate under specific regulatory parameters that shape how slots are played. Since April 2020, credit cards have been off the table for gambling transactions in Great Britain, so all slot play must be funded through debit cards, e-wallets, or bank transfers. Additionally, stake limits for online slots were introduced in 2025: the maximum is £5 per spin for most players, reduced to £2 per spin for those aged 18 to 24. These limits are designed to curb excessive losses, and they apply across all UKGC-licensed operators.
Responsible session structure is about more than compliance. A sensible approach is to decide your total budget before you open a game, divide it into smaller session stakes, and walk away when either your win target or loss limit is reached. Many operators offer deposit limits, session timers, and reality checks that alert you to how long you have been playing. Use them. Slots are entertainment with a cost, not a route to income, and treating them as such is the difference between a hobby and a problem. Before You Play: Terms Worth Knowing
When you claim a bonus to play these slots, the wagering requirements determine how much you must stake before withdrawing any winnings. These are commercial terms set by individual operators, not legal requirements, and they commonly range from about 20x to 65x the bonus amount. A £50 bonus at 35x wagering means you must place £1,750 in bets before your winnings become withdrawable. Always read the terms before accepting any offer.
| Term | Plain-English Meaning | Practical Note |
|---|---|---|
| Wagering requirement | The multiplier applied to your bonus that dictates total bets needed before withdrawal | Lower is better; 20x is generous, 65x is demanding |
| Game contribution | Percentage of each bet that counts towards wagering | Slots usually contribute 100%; table games often less |
| Max bet during wagering | The highest stake allowed while clearing a bonus | Typically £5 per spin; exceeding it voids the bonus |
| Time limit | Days allowed to meet wagering requirements | Usually 7-30 days; check before you accept |
| Win cap | Maximum amount you can withdraw from bonus winnings | Often 10x to 20x the bonus value |

Why do progressive jackpot slots have lower RTP figures?
Progressive jackpots fund their prize pools by taking a small percentage from every stake placed, which reduces the base-game RTP. Mega Moolah’s 88.12% RTP reflects this trade-off: you accept a higher house edge in exchange for a shot at a life-changing payout. If you play jackpot slots, treat them as a lottery ticket with entertainment value, not as a primary strategy for steady returns.
